Description
This restoration project will address high priority ecological concerns in Nason Creek by establishing a perennial side channel with connection to off channel wetland habitat, installing wood structures to increase instream complexity and habitat, and establishing riparian vegetation in the floodplain and newly created side channel. The project is located on Chelan-Douglas Land Trust property at RM 10.8 - 11 on Nason Creek. The project will benefit ESA listed spring Chinook salmon, steelhead, and bull trout in Nason Creek. Project work will include limited invasive plant control and riparian plant removal when needed to achieve project goals.
Project Benefit
The goal of this project is to improve abundance, productivity and spatial structure for ESA-listed species by addressing the highest priority ecological concerns in Nason Creek, which is the highest priority Assessment Unit for restoration in in the Wenatchee watershed. The ecological concerns that this project will address in priority order are:
1) Peripheral and Transitional Habitat (Side Channel and Wetland Connections)
2) Channel Structure and Form (Bed and Channel Form)
3) Riparian Condition
4) Channel Structure and Form (Instream Structural Complexity)
